A refreshing local salad of tomato, green pepper, onion, olive oil, and often tuna or boiled egg. It is a Jaén classic, especially valued for its excellent extra virgin olive oil.
A traditional Jaén stew made with flat pieces of rustic dough simmered with rabbit, hare, or cod and vegetables. It is one of the province's most emblematic countryside dishes.
A rustic mash of potato, garlic, olive oil, and sometimes egg. It is a humble, traditional dish from Jaén that highlights the region's olive oil.

Jaén is cheaper than Spain’s biggest cities. Meals, coffee, and local transport are generally good value for tourists.
Tipping is modest. Round up or leave 5-10% in restaurants for good service. Small change in cafés is enough. Taxis are usually rounded up, but tips are not expected.
